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our technicians will inspect your living room to assess the extent of the damage and identify any potential safety hazards. We’ll take note of the type of water involved (clean, gray, or black) and the level of moisture in the affected area. This information will help us find out the best course of action to take.

Step 2: Water Removal

Using our advanced equipment, we’ll remove as much water as possible from your living room. We’ll use wet/dry vacuums to suck up standing water and d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ized drying equipment to dry your living room, including fans and dehumidifiers. This will help to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ection

Once your living room is dry, we’ll use specialized cleaning products to remove any remaining moisture and prevent mold growth. We’ll also disinfect any surfaces to ensure your home is safe and healthy.

Step 5: Restoration and Repairs

Finally, we’ll work with you to restore your living room to its original condition. This may involve repairing or replacing damaged materials, such as drywall or flooring.

Warning Signs You Need Living Room Water Removal

Water damage can happen quickly and quietly, making it essential to be aware of the warning signs. Here are a few common signs that you may need Living Room Water Removal services: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ty or mildewy smell in your living room that won’t go away, it’s a sign that there’s moisture present. This can lead to mold growth and further damage if left unchecked.

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any stains, it’s essential to investigate the source of the leak and have it repaired as soon as possible.

Buckled or Warped Flooring

Buckled or warped fl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s essential to investigate the cause and have it repaired or replaced as needed.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any peeling or bubbling, it’s essential to investigate the cause and have it repaired or replaced as needed.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

If you notice any unusual sounds or leaks in your living room, it’s essential to investigate the cause and have it repaired as soon as possible.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age, such as standing water or water-soaked carpets, is a clear sign that you need Living Room Water Removal services.

Q: What happens if I don’t address water damage quickly?

A: If you don’t address water damage quickly, it can lead to further damage and health risks. Mold growth can occur, and electrical systems can be compromised, leading to costly repairs and even safety hazards. It’s essential to address water damage as soon as possible to prevent further damage and ensure your home is safe and healthy.
